First signs of spring?

King George Road, South Shields, grey morning but the temperatures are starting to improve. After a couple of weeks of harsh frosts we can look forward to balmy temperatures in the range of five to nine Celsius each day!

I’m not sure if this batch of crocus is showing it’s head a little early this year or if this the normal time for them to appear, it feels a little early.

Camera details; Pentax K100D, 28mm lens, 1/60 second, f22, iso 200, mini tripod.
